Butterflies of Monterey County

  • Olivia & Daisy 13766 Center Street Carmel Valley, CA, 93924 United States (map)

Spring is fast approaching! Join us for a celebration of Butterflies of Monterey County on Tue, Apr 16, 2024 at 12:00 PM at Olivia & Daisy Books. This event is a wonderful opportunity to learn about the diverse and colorful butterflies that call Monterey County home. While many know and appreciate the Monarch migration that passes through Pacific Grove, there are 91 species of butterfly here to discover and appreciate.

Come enjoy a presentation and discussion of the research that brought Chris Tenney and Jan Austin's debut field guide, Butterflies of Monterey County, to life. Books available for sale as well as special edition butterfly art from local artist, Lindsey Klinger.

Optional accessible nature walk and butterfly watch at Carmel River to follow, pending favorable conditions.

Chris Tenney is a retired schoolteacher and amateur naturalist. After co-authoring Birds of Monterey County (with Don Roberson), his passion shifted from birds to butterflies. He began an inventory of Monterey County butterflies in 2005 and now collaborates with Professor Ryan Hill and students at UOP Stockton on various studies of the butterfly subgenus Speyeria.

Jan Austin is a writer/photographer with a life-long love of nature. She is a fourth-generation Monterey County resident. She loves ballroom dancing, hiking, comedy improv and time with her dogs Joy and Star. You can find her photography here.

Lindsey Klinger is a Pacific Grove based photographer and artist whose original art, mixed-media, linocut & watercolor feature one-of-a-kind interpretations of butterflies, moths, and the natural world.
